Submersible Deep Well Water Pumps An Essential Tool for Efficient Water Extraction


Submersible deep well water pumps play a critical role in water extraction from deep underground sources. These innovative pumps are designed to operate underwater, making them particularly effective for accessing groundwater supplies in a variety of applications, including residential, agricultural, and industrial settings.


Understanding Submersible Pumps


At their core, submersible pumps are electric pumps that are fully submerged in the water they are designed to pump. Unlike traditional centrifugal pumps that work by drawing up water, submersible pumps push water to the surface. This unique design offers several advantages, chief among them being efficiency and reliability in challenging conditions.


The submersible pump consists of several key components, including a motor, impellers, and a discharge head. The motor is typically sealed to prevent any water from entering, and the pump itself is housed in a sturdy casing that protects against sediment and other debris. This design not only enhances durability but also reduces the risk of overheating and wear.


Advantages of Submersible Deep Well Pumps


1. High Efficiency Submersible pumps are highly efficient at moving water from considerable depths. Their design allows them to operate under high-pressure conditions while maintaining a consistent flow rate.


2. No Priming Needed Since these pumps are submerged, they do not require priming. This feature simplifies the installation process and reduces the need for maintenance that typically accompanies surface pumps.


3. Versatility Submersible pumps can be used in various applications, from providing water for irrigation systems on farms to supplying drinking water for residential homes. They can also serve industrial needs, such as dewatering construction sites.

4. Energy Savings Many submersible pumps are designed to be energy-efficient, minimizing operational costs. In an era where energy consumption is scrutinized, these pumps provide a cost-effective solution for long-term water sourcing.


5. Space-Saving Design Submersible pumps are compact and do not require a complex setup above ground, allowing for more efficient use of space, especially in areas where land availability is limited.


Applications of Submersible Pumps


Submersible deep well pumps are increasingly being employed in various sectors. In agriculture, they allow farmers to efficiently access groundwater for irrigation, particularly during dry spells when surface water is scarce. In residential applications, homeowners use these pumps to draw water from deep wells for drinking, cooking, and cleaning purposes.


Additionally, industries often rely on submersible pumps for processes such as water supply, cooling systems, and wastewater management. The versatility of these pumps ensures they can handle diverse challenges across different fields.


Choosing the Right Pump


When selecting a submersible deep well water pump, factors such as well depth, the diameter of the well, and water demand need to be taken into account. It is essential to choose a pump that not only fits the specific application but also functions efficiently within the required parameters. Consulting with professionals or manufacturers can help ensure the best selection for individual needs.
